WebFeb 27, 2012 · Since the neonatal Ebstein's anomaly with circular shunt was considered a fatal condition, emergent surgical treatment was required. A two-stage, palliative operation was planned; the first stage was ligation of the pulmonary artery to eliminate the circular shunting, and the second stage was a modified Starnes operation after the neonatal ... WebEbstein anomaly is a rare congenital heart disease character-ized by downward displacement of the tricuspid valve into the right ventricle and accounts for 0.3% of congenital heart disease cases [1-3].
